Sherline headstocks and parts can be found in a variety of models from the factory. Normally ER16 and MT1. Both of which are really small. Sherline also provides WW collet sets for really small work. Mainly watchmakers and clockmakers use the WW collets. Most prefer ER25, ER32 and even ER40 collet sizes with a bigger spindle go through hole. The 5C collet for the Sherline lathe would be the very best. For Sherline mills, the majority of really don’t care for the MT1 and barely like the ER16. An R8 spindle with a low profile would be best. It provides the most versatility and many tool choices. You can find many reviews on both the lathe and the mill. Popular models are the 2000, 5400, 4000 and 4500 in metric and inch. The also been available in CNC, handbook and CNC prepared variations. Just recently, they have actually added ballscrew versions for sale. This is far better than the older leadscrew type. Taig likewise provides lathes and mills. It’s Sherlines main competition. In truth, you can discover a lot of videos and posts referring to Taig vs Sherline. The Taig products offer far more stiff ways and generally more “strong” in general. The Taig motors are quite weak, similar to the Sherline motors. A high quality brushless motor can make the machine appear like a totally various mill or lathe. Taig likewise offers a great CNC all set mill and lathe. You can likewise opt for their digital CNC system which utilizes closed-looped steppers and Mach3 software application. The Taig spindles have the exact same issues as the Sherline. They are far too little. The only exception is the 5C collet headstock model they provide. We will do a review of the 5C in the future. The good thing is that they now use a ballscrew choice for their mill and lathe. Plus, the offer a “gang tool” lathe. The disadvantage with both produces is the absence of serious upgrades.
Sherline offers numerous parts and attachments, however very little to make it a better machine. To begin with, they headstock uses bad quality bearings and the bearings are too little. This indicates the spindle itself needs to be small. A spindle with extremely little mass suggests the lathe or mill the surface quality will not be as good and based on vibration issues. For example, they use lots of lathe devices, but you can’t get a 5C headstock or ER25, ER32 or ER40. Plus, the go through hole needs to be small due to the fact that the bearings are little. There is a comparable problem with the mill. You can only utilize ER16 collets and this limits its usage. Of course those in Orrville, Ohio 44667 may have different needs.
